Firestone Assessment of Violent Thoughts (FAVT-A) Introductory Kit
123427
Robert W. Firestone,Lisa A. Firestone

The FAVT-A is designed to be a brief, efficient indicator of an individual's violence potential. Based on the adult version of the FAVT, this 35-item self-report assesses the underlying thoughts that predispose violent behavior in individuals ages 11-18 years. It can help you screen for violence potential, determine whether or not a verbal threat will lead to a violent act, plan clinical intervention, and monitor progress and outcomes.

Structured Interview of Reported Symptoms, 2nd Edition (SIRS-2) Introductory Kit
124736
Richard Rogers, Kenneth W. Sewell, Nathan D. Gillard

The SIRS has been in use for almost 20 years and has been validated with clinical, community, and correctional populations, making it appropriate in civil and clinical settings as well as forensic settings.
